Lets compare vitamin content per 7 ounces of Oil Roasted Almonds vs Peanuts:
- 7 ounces of Oil Roasted Almonds have 5.8 times more Vitamin B2 and 3.1 times more Vitamin E than Peanuts.
- While 7 oz of Raw Peanuts contain 7 times more Vitamin B1, 3.3 times more Vitamin B3, 7.7 times more Vitamin B5, 2.9 times more Vitamin B6 and 8.9 times more Vitamin B9 than Oil Roasted Almonds.
- Both Oil Roasted Almonds as well as Raw Peanuts have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12, Vitamin C, Vitamin D and Vitamin K in seven ounces.
Comparing minerals per 7 ounces for Oil Roasted Almonds vs Peanuts:
- 7 ounces of Oil Roasted Almonds have 3.2 times more Calcium, 1.6 times more Magnesium, 1.3 times more Manganese and 1.2 times more Phosphorus than Peanuts.
- While 7 oz of Raw Peanuts contain 1.8 times more Selenium than Oil Roasted Almonds.
- Both Oil Roasted Almonds and Peanuts contain similar levels of Copper, Iron, Potassium and Zinc per seven ounces.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 7 ounces:
- 7 ounces of Oil Roasted Almonds have 1.2 times more Fiber than Peanuts.
- While 7 oz of Raw Peanuts contain 1.5 times more Saturated Fat than Oil Roasted Almonds.
- Both Oil Roasted Almonds and Peanuts offer comparable quantities of Energy, Fat, Omega 6, Carbohydrate, Sugars and Protein per seven ounces.
- Both Oil Roasted Almonds as well as Raw Peanuts prov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3 in seven ounces.
